Saratoga County, NY – Fatal Crash on Northway (I-87) Near Exit 11

1 person killed in Northway crash

Saratoga County, NY (November 23, 2025) – One person was killed in a fatal accident Sunday evening on Interstate 87 South in Saratoga County, according to New York State Police.

The crash occurred around 8:00 p.m., south of Exit 11 near Round Lake on the southbound lanes of the Northway (I-87). Authorities have not released the name of the deceased at this time.

State Police confirm the collision involved at least one vehicle, and emergency crews quickly responded to the scene. All southbound lanes between Exit 11 and Exit 10 were closed for several hours as troopers investigated the cause of the crash. Traffic was being rerouted, and drivers were advised to reduce speed as they passed through the area.

Investigations are ongoing, and New York State Police are continuing to gather more details about the crash. As of now, further information has not been disclosed.

What to Do After a Fatal Crash in New York

In New York, fatal accidents can be complicated legal matters. Surviving family members may be eligible for wrongful death claims, which can cover funeral expenses, loss of companionship, and medical costs. A thorough investigation, including witness statements, police reports, and evidence gathering, is essential for holding responsible parties accountable.
